Fast finality just means you can reuse the same collateral over and over really quickly. That's velocity, not depth. They're not the same thing.

Think about it this way: a $10M pool is $10M deep right now, in this moment. Doesn't matter how fast it settles. If two big trades both want to clear at the same instant, they can't both pull from that $10M. Speed doesn't fix that. So "infinite depth" oversells it. What you're actually describing is more like "a small amount of parked capital can do a huge amount of volume," which is genuinely cool, just not the same claim.

Also, reusing one collateral unit again and again against new trades is honestly pretty close to the rehypothecation you're saying this avoids. The risk doesn't disappear, it just gets squeezed into a few seconds.

“Any staking rewards generated from the Trust’s HBAR holdings will accrue to the benefit of the Sponsor as partial compensation for its services to the Trust, and will not accrue to the Trust or benefit Shareholders.”

They can stake the ETF’s HBAR (and the Sponsor covers the costs), but Shareholders get zero of the rewards. On Hedera, staking yields are currently around 1.8–2.5%. That’s real yield you’re missing out on if you hold HBAR yourself.
